CVE-2026-73177
Nozomi Networks Labs identified a CWE-345: Insufficient Verification of Data Authenticity vulnerability in the firmware upgrade mechanism. The device accepts firmware images through the authenticated web management interface without performing any cryptographic signature or certificate verification.
An authenticated administrator-level attacker may install arbitrary modified firmware on the device, enabling full persistent compromise of the platform.

This issue affects: Advantech EKI-1242IEIMS and EKI-1242EIMS in firmware version V1.06.01.
CVE-2026-73177
C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:H/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N
8.6
Update to firmware version 2.00.01.
